Results typically last two to six weeks depending on hair growth cycles and individual factors. Regular appointments can extend intervals as hair becomes finer. RC's technicians advise scheduling based on visible regrowth and personal preference for maintenance.

Most clients report mild discomfort similar to plucking. Techniques, expert speed, and proper skin support minimize pain. Apply a numbing cream only if recommended; breathing and relaxation techniques can help. Pain usually subsides quickly after treatment.

Avoid exfoliating or using retinol 48 hours before your appointment. Clean, dry skin helps precision. Bring a list of skincare products and inform your technician about medications or sensitivities so we can adjust the treatment for your Chin area.

Yes, Chin threading can be safe when performed by experienced technicians. We assess skin condition beforehand and avoid threading over active, inflamed acne. Post-care and gentle products are recommended to reduce irritation and prevent complications.

Most clients book Chin threading every three to six weeks depending on growth rate. Regular appointments can make hair finer over time, lengthening intervals. We’ll recommend a personalized schedule during your visit based on results and preferences.

Threading removes hair at the follicle and can reduce ingrown risk compared with shaving. To prevent ingrowns, exfoliate gently between appointments, moisturize daily, and avoid picking. If ingrowns appear, consult our technician for targeted treatments and guidance.
